界面编程用什么软件吗
-
界面编程可以使用多种软件来实现,以下是一些常用的界面编程软件:
-
Qt:Qt是一种跨平台的应用程序开发框架,可以用于开发图形用户界面(GUI)应用程序。Qt提供了丰富的界面控件和布局管理器,支持C++编程语言,并且具有良好的可移植性和易用性。
-
JavaFX:JavaFX是Java平台上的一套用户界面库,用于创建富客户端应用程序。JavaFX提供了丰富的界面控件和布局管理器,支持Java编程语言,并且与Java语言集成紧密。
-
Windows Forms:Windows Forms是微软的桌面应用程序开发框架,用于在Windows操作系统上创建GUI应用程序。Windows Forms提供了丰富的界面控件和布局管理器,支持C#和VB.NET等编程语言。
-
WPF:Windows Presentation Foundation(WPF)是微软的桌面应用程序开发框架,用于在Windows操作系统上创建富客户端应用程序。WPF提供了强大的界面布局和样式化功能,支持XAML语言和C#等编程语言。
-
HTML/CSS/JavaScript:对于Web界面编程,可以使用HTML、CSS和JavaScript来创建动态和交互性的用户界面。HTML负责定义页面结构,CSS用于样式化页面元素,JavaScript则负责实现交互逻辑。
以上是常用的界面编程软件,选择合适的软件取决于项目需求、开发平台和个人技术偏好。
1年前 -
-
界面编程是指开发一个具有可视化界面(GUI)的软件应用程序。在界面编程中,开发人员可以使用多种软件工具来设计和开发应用程序的用户界面。以下是一些常用的界面编程软件:
-
Visual Studio:Visual Studio是微软的集成开发环境(IDE),被广泛用于开发Windows应用程序。它提供了一个可视化的界面设计器,可以轻松地创建和布局用户界面元素,如按钮、文本框、列表框等。开发人员可以使用C#、VB.NET等编程语言来编写应用程序的逻辑代码。
-
Xcode:Xcode是苹果公司为开发Mac和iOS应用程序而推出的开发工具。它提供了一个可视化界面构建器,称为Interface Builder,可以用于创建用户界面。开发人员可以使用Objective-C或Swift编程语言来编写应用程序的逻辑代码。
-
Android Studio:Android Studio是谷歌公司推出的用于开发Android应用程序的集成开发环境。它包含了一个可视化的布局编辑器,可以用于设计和构建Android应用程序的用户界面。开发人员可以使用Java或Kotlin编程语言来编写应用程序的逻辑代码。
-
Qt Creator:Qt Creator是专门用于开发跨平台应用程序的集成开发环境。它提供了一个可视化的界面设计器,可以用于创建和布局用户界面元素。Qt Creator支持C++编程语言,开发人员可以使用Qt框架来编写应用程序的逻辑代码。
-
Adobe XD:Adobe XD是一个专业的界面设计工具,可以用于设计和原型化应用程序的用户界面。它提供了多种界面元素和交互设计工具,适用于各种平台和设备。开发人员可以使用导出功能将设计稿转化为代码,以便在实际应用程序中实现。
这些界面编程软件各有特点,选择合适的工具取决于应用程序的需求、目标平台和开发人员的个人偏好。
1年前 -
-
界面编程可以使用许多不同的软件工具,根据个人的技能和项目需求选择适合自己的工具。以下是一些常见的界面编程软件:
-
Visual Studio:Visual Studio是微软开发的集成开发环境(IDE),用于开发 Microsoft Windows 平台的应用程序。它提供了广泛的界面编程工具和库,如 Windows Forms、WPF(Windows Presentation Foundation)和 UWP(Universal Windows Platform)。
-
Qt:Qt是一款跨平台的界面编程框架,提供了丰富的用户界面控件和功能。它支持多种操作系统,包括 Windows、macOS、Linux 等。Qt 的界面编程工具能够轻松创建现代化、响应式的应用程序界面。
-
Android Studio:Android Studio是谷歌针对 Android 平台开发的官方IDE。它提供了丰富的功能和工具,使开发者可以轻松地创建 Android 应用程序的用户界面。Android Studio 使用 Java 或 Kotlin 进行界面编程。
-
Xcode:Xcode是苹果公司开发的一款用于开发 macOS 和 iOS 应用程序的集成开发环境。它提供了 Interface Builder 工具,使开发者可以直观地设计和布局应用程序的用户界面。
-
HTML/CSS/JavaScript:对于网页界面编程,可以使用前端开发技术,如 HTML、CSS 和 JavaScript。HTML 负责定义页面的结构,CSS 用于设计页面的样式,JavaScript 用于实现交互和动态效果。
-
Unity 3D:Unity 3D 是一款跨平台的游戏引擎,也被广泛用于开发应用程序的用户界面。它以其强大的用户界面创建工具和图形渲染功能而闻名,可用于开发 PC、移动设备和虚拟现实等多种平台上的应用程序。
请根据你的具体需求和技能选择适合的界面编程软件,这些只是其中的一部分常见工具。对于初学者来说,可以先选择使用相对简单易用的工具进行界面编程,然后随着经验的积累逐步尝试更复杂的工具和框架。
1年前 -